Stucco painting services involve applying a fresh coat of paint over existing stucco surfaces or creating a new, decorative finish on exterior or interior walls. This process typically includes preparing the surface to ensure proper adhesion, repairing any cracks or damaged areas, and then applying primer and paint to achieve a smooth, durable, and visually appealing finish. Skilled contractors may also incorporate specialized techniques or textures to enhance the property's aesthetic, making the walls look more refined and well-maintained.
This service can help address common problems such as peeling, cracking, or fading paint that often occur on stucco exteriors over time. It also provides an effective way to protect the underlying material from moisture and weather-related damage, which can lead to more serious issues if left untreated. Whether a property has experienced previous damage or simply shows signs of aging, professional stucco painting can restore its appearance and extend the life of the surface.

The overview below groups typical Stucco Painting proj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Celina,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or stucco touch-ups or small patching jobs in Celina, TX, range from $250 to $600. Many routine repairs fall within this middle range, depending on the size and complexity of the area.
Standard Painting Projects - For painting larger sections of stucco surfaces, local contractors often charge between $1,000 and $3,000. Most projects of this scale tend to stay within this range, with fewer exceeding it.
Full Surface Repainting - Complete repainting of a home’s exterior stucco can cost between $3,500 and $7,000, depending on the size and condition of the surface. Larger or more detailed projects may push beyond this range.
Full Replacement - When a full stucco removal and replacement is needed, costs typically start around $8,000 and can go over $15,000 for extensive or high-end homes. These projects are less common and usually represent the upper end of the cost spectrum.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is stucco painting? Stucco painting involves applying a protective and decorative finish to exterior or interior stucco surfaces, enhancing their appearance and durability.
Are there different types of stucco finishes? Yes, there are various stucco finishes such as smooth, textured, or sand finish, which can be selected based on aesthetic preferences and the surface's needs.
Can local contractors handle both repair and painting of stucco surfaces? Many service providers offer both repair and painting services for stucco, ensuring a cohesive and professional finish.
What surfaces are suitable for stucco painting? Stucco painting is suitable for exterior walls, interior accent walls, and other surfaces with existing stucco or similar textured finishes.
How do local pros prepare stucco surfaces for painting? Preparation typically includes cleaning the surface, repairing any cracks or damage, and applying a primer to ensure proper adhesion of the paint.
